One of Sitges’ smallest beaches, with water in front and boats behind. Located next to the Ginesta marina, it is an isolated and peaceful option. It can also be a starting or a finishing point for an excursion in Parc del Garraf. You can access the cove by foot, leaving the car on the road, or through the port.

Boundaries
East: breakwater and port barrier West: cliffs

Signage
Beach marked out at 200 m. No entry or exit channel for boats. Animals (except guide dogs), are prohibited in public bathing areas, on the sand or in the water. EMAS, ISO 14.001 and Biosphere Certification.
